SimScale already offers generous free access through its Community Plan and Academic Program, providing thousands of core hours of legitimate simulation time at no cost. For those needing more than these options provide, a range of paid plans offers affordable access to professional-grade simulation capabilities. And for users who require completely free, open source solutions, alternatives like OpenFOAM, CalculiX, Elmer, and Code_Aster provide powerful legitimate options.
